Are you convinced Jesus is “the Holy One of God?” Imagine if you will being the tyrant seeking death upon others because they believe God sent His Only Son amongst them to take upon His Body the torment for sins forgiven by a Redemptive Resurrection granted only once. Taken to the ground and blinded by the Light of Christ, Saul who would soon be living the life of Saint Paul becoming convinced to overcome the blindness he led in persecuting the early Christians transitioning from foe to friend regaining his sight from the Light of Truth preaching so strong in Damascus the Jews conspired to kill him before he was lowered in a basket out a window to escape traveling to Jerusalem.

There he began his Apostleship with the help of Barnabas for all the Apostles were afraid of him. “When he arrived in Jerusalem he tried to join the disciples, but they were all afraid of him, not believing that he was a disciple.” Acts 9:26 Maybe you feel like Saul today for in the resistance you feel around you is now making you become even stronger in Christ never fearing when we speak “out boldly in the name of the LORD.” Saul accepted the Spirit of God to overcome his desires of the flesh seeking not the will of a loin lanced with a coin but the Will of God Divine speaking the Truth every time.
Each of us must find our life in Christ amongst the confused being a beacon as Saul became for the Light of God’s Spirit illuminates your surrender to charity in loving thy neighbor as thy self. You see the desire of God’s love radiating from the eyes of the lost, lonely and languished labeled as “mental” or “worthless” obviously living in Truth by life’s complicated decisions of sin when you travel your days across any town in the world. They crave the message of Truth just as the people of Christ’s time who witnessed in seeing His miracles of faith, hope and love embracing charity to guide them all to Eternal Life.

Many times I come across these human souls in my travels extending a hand or a smile with soothing sounds of Christ’s hope. Yesterday, I was struck by one as our eyes met seeing the desperation of sincerity. “I am hungry, I am Dirty, I am in need” was the Spirit driven thought I felt in the Life of a Child of God. While speaking to and praying over a man who kept saying, “I want to do better,” I shared a KFC meal with him that included all the fixings learning he craved a long hot shower and a soft bed we take for granted each day. Let us reach out and share the love of Christ in the people we sight by the eyes of His Light. Amen.
